commit r16-5156-gd9b94a5efc0c427f1d2bf018a782475b1324ffcd Author: Lulu Cheng <[email protected]> Date: Wed Oct 15 16:53:16 2025 +0800 LoongArch: Add support for setting priority in fmv. gcc/ChangeLog: * config/loongarch/loongarch-protos.h (loongarch_parse_fmv_features): Modify the type of parameter. (loongarch_compare_version_priority): Function declaration. * config/loongarch/loongarch-target-attr.cc (enum features_prio): Define LA_PRIO_MAX to indicate the highest priority of supported attributes. (loongarch_parse_fmv_features): Added handling of setting priority in attribute string. (loongarch_compare_version_priority): Likewise. * config/loongarch/loongarch.cc (loongarch_process_target_version_attr): Likewise. (get_feature_mask_for_version): Likewise. (loongarch_compare_version_priority): Delete.
